The Blessing of the Animals is a ceremonial event, often held in conjunction with the feast day of St. Francis of Assisi, the patron saint of animals and the environment. During this blessing, pets and other animals are brought to a religious service or gathering to receive a special blessing, emphasizing the importance of caring for all living creatures. This tradition highlights the connection between humans and animals, fostering a sense of stewardship and compassion towards the natural world. It serves as a reminder of the spiritual significance of animals in our lives.
